    car wont start

    Hey guys, ive got a 2000 v6 coupe and for the past few weeks ive had all kinds of trouble getting it started. Of course the first thing i did was replace the battery since i hadent replaced it in about 2 years. That didnt help. So then i had my step dad look at it ( he works for chevy ) and he said the starter motor (he had some funny name for it) needed to be replaced. He replaced it for me and it was fine for about 2 days and now its having troubles starting again. In fact it wouldnt start at all today. :-( I do have a 900rms amp hooked up to 2 12" subs but have never had any problems with voltage drop or electrical issues even with them slammin. If anyone has any ideas of what the problem could be, please, help me. Thanks.

    When you turn the key on do you hear the fuel pump prime and have you checked the fuel pressure? I don't want to send you on a wild goose chase but I would check to see if you're getting spark and then check to see if you're getting fuel. That would be the first things I would check.

    When you turn the key to run but don't start the car you should hear a little buzzing type sound that lasts about 2 seconds coming from the rear of the car. That's your pump priming.

    when you turn your key too the run position, stick your head out the door and listen, Its kinda like a high pitch whineing, You will know if you hear it or not.
    Hook up a fuel pressue guage and see if your gettin fuel, If you are then check for spark like said above, You can either get a nifty "in line" tester. You hook on end too plug and one end into wire and crank too see if the lil light inside lights up or just pull a plug and try and arc it off of something metallic.
